D.ZOOM

[OFF], [ 40X], [ 200X] Determines the operation of the digital zoom.

When activated, the camcorder will

switch automatically to the digital zoom when you zoom in beyond the optical zoom range.

With the digital zoom the image is digitally processed, so the image resolution will deteriorate the more you zoom in.

The digital zoom indicator will appear in light blue from 10x up to 40x and dark blue from 40x up to 200x.

The digital zoom cannot be used with the [ NIGHT] recording program.

A still image cannot be recorded simultaneously on the memory card while recording movies using the digital zoom.
